Transaction 25850613918b93dc4ed06097baf04e393dbfe333138a2922030671041ea49ea2

2 Input
2 Outputs
  • 25850613918b93dc4ed06097baf04e393dbfe333138a2922030671041ea49ea2:0
  • value  460000
    address  3F7Hkb5KkznCm182Cix42U9x2fyVMSWqgu
  • 25850613918b93dc4ed06097baf04e393dbfe333138a2922030671041ea49ea2:1
  • value  419392
    address  1LcLC2Vzj9CukLseWYtCq3HDoX9kP7w3ze